The structure of contemporary football player welfare relies on grasping the complex physical demands imposed upon professional athletes through training and competition. Today\'s footballers withstand extraordinary physical strain, with elite athletes covering lengths going beyond 10 kilometers per game while carrying out high-intensity sprints, jumps, and directional changes. This demanding environment necessitates advanced tracking systems that track every detail from heart monitoring variability to muscle mass fatigue signals. Cutting-edge wearable tech currently provides real-time data on player workload, enabling mentoring team to make educated judgments concerning training intensity and recovery periods. Football injury prevention has emerged as a crucial component of contemporary club management, with teams spending significant resources in evidence-based strategies to reduce the risk of player problems. Modern prevention programs target identifying and more info resolving biomechanical inequalities, muscle deficiencies, and movement routines that incline players to particular injury categories. Extensive screening methods currently analyze every detail from ankle joint flexibility to hip steadiness, creating comprehensive profiles of each player's physical traits and probable weak points. Such evaluations guide targeted tactics that may embrace reparative exercises, personalized training intensity, or specialized equipment usage.
